Forests Of Our Minds
Like forests, childlike imagination,
comfortable, hides in my mind,
in yours and never comes out to play,
since real monsters:
mortgages, equitable income, taxes
and need for health insurance.

When do we peer out from behind these trees,
decide it’s safe to play in fields?
Some clearing from dank, moss woods,
glimpse spectacular mountain peaks,
daring blue sky compare?

Do we venture out, seek the tides
of moon-promise rolling,
let those wet dogs lap our weary feet?
Do we attune our ears, hear
wind whistling through bright foliage,
spy for denizens that would near
to harmonize with their uncaged melodies?

Where does sheltered love brave, risk
elements, venture as a curious child again?

Imagine, we could be alone in the dark
with no one to hold a hand.
Imagine, we are all alone in our forests,
not seeking one another, too afraid to play.

From behind those trees we are never free
from our daunting fears, with
true vistas calling, curtained from Hope,
partitioned from Dreams, only nightmares.

Childlike inspiration aspires
under the blackest mask, pierced
by a distant-calling in our forests,
yet white stars wink we're okay.
Let’s lay in the grass tonight.
